Basement Toilet Installation in Denver, CO
Basement toilet installation services involve the setup of a new toilet in a basement space, whether for a full bathroom remodel, a basement upgrade, or the addition of a new restroom area. These projects typically include connecting the toilet to existing plumbing lines, ensuring proper waste removal, and making sure the fixture is securely installed and functional. Homeowners often request this service when finishing a basement, creating a guest bathroom, or replacing an old or damaged toilet to improve convenience and functionality in lower-level living spaces.
Before requesting basement toilet install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including any necessary plumbing modifications, space measurements, and potential drainage considerations. It’s also common to inquire about the compatibility of the new toilet with existing plumbing setups and any permits or inspections that may be required for the project. Having clear details about the basement layout and plumbing infrastructure helps ensure the installation process proceeds smoothly and meets the specific needs of the space.

Basement Toilet Installation Questions
What are common reasons to install a basement toilet? Installing a basement toilet can improve convenience, add a bathroom for guests, or increase property value by creating additional functionality.
Is it possible to add a toilet in an existing basement? Yes, existing plumbing and proper drainage are needed, but many basement spaces can be adapted for toilet installation.
What should homeowners consider before installing a basement toilet? Consider access to plumbing, space availability, and local building codes to ensure proper installation and function.
Are there different types of basement toilets available? Yes, options include standard gravity-flush toilets, low-flow models, and wall-mounted styles to suit various preferences and space constraints.
